/*
* highmem.h: virtual kernel memory mappings for high memory
*
* Used in CONFIG_HIGHMEM systems for memory pages which
* are not addressable by direct kernel virtual addresses.
*
* Copyright (C) 1999 Gerhard Wichert, Siemens AG
* Gerhard.Wichert@pdb.siemens.de
*
*
* Redesigned the x86 32-bit VM architecture to deal with
* up to 16 Terrabyte physical memory. With current x86 CPUs
* we now support up to 64 Gigabytes physical RAM.
*
* Copyright (C) 1999 Ingo Molnar <mingo@redhat.com>
*/
#ifndef _ASM_HIGHMEM_H
#define _ASM_HIGHMEM_H
#ifdef __KERNEL__
#include <linux/interrupt.h>
#include <asm/kmap_types.h>
/* undef for production */
#define HIGHMEM_DEBUG 1
/* in mm/highmem.c */
extern void *kmap_high(struct page *page, int nonblocking);
extern void kunmap_high(struct page *page);
/* declarations for highmem.c */
extern unsigned long highstart_pfn, highend_pfn;
extern pte_t *kmap_pte;
extern pgprot_t kmap_prot;
extern pte_t *pkmap_page_table;
/* This gets set in {srmmu,sun4c}_paging_init() */
extern unsigned long fix_kmap_begin;
/* Only used and set with srmmu? */
extern unsigned long pkmap_base;
extern void kmap_init(void) __init;
/*
* Right now we initialize only a single pte table. It can be extended
* easily, subsequent pte tables have to be allocated in one physical
* chunk of RAM.
*/
#define LAST_PKMAP 1024
#define LAST_PKMAP_MASK (LAST_PKMAP - 1)
#define PKMAP_NR(virt) ((virt - pkmap_base) >> PAGE_SHIFT)
#define PKMAP_ADDR(nr) (pkmap_base + ((nr) << PAGE_SHIFT))
/* in arch/sparc/mm/highmem.c */
void *kmap_atomic(struct page *page, enum km_type type);
void kunmap_atomic(void *kvaddr, enum km_type type);
#define kmap(page) __kmap(page, 0)
#define kmap_nonblock(page) __kmap(page, 1)
static inline void *__kmap(struct page *page, int nonblocking)
{
if (in_interrupt())
BUG();
if (page < highmem_start_page)
return page_address(page);
return kmap_high(page, nonblocking);
}
static inline void kunmap(struct page *page)
{
if (in_interrupt())
BUG();
if (page < highmem_start_page)
return;
kunmap_high(page);
}
#endif /* __KERNEL__ */
#endif /* _ASM_HIGHMEM_H */
